Transaction 622a766c33b48e13d8477b6c0bc3ceb8266c12ea7467969d912a4e08db0e0b52
1 Input
1 Output
-
622a766c33b48e13d8477b6c0bc3ceb8266c12ea7467969d912a4e08db0e0b52:0
- value
- 3597053
- script pubkey
- OP_0 OP_PUSHBYTES_20 87d0addcabebeea3343fd59eba2590d0a0dfb4d0
- address
- bc1qslg2mh9ta0h2xdpl6k0t5fvs6zsdldxs9rmsw9